Sometimes
I sense a world
Beyond a wall
I cannot see
Cannot breach

Something
Tantalizingly near
Excruciatingly remote
Intangibly real
Exquisitely beautiful

A mote
In the corner of one eye
Visible only
In the periphery
Invisible looking straight on

But then
Every now and again
I awake on the other side
With the shock
Of a body blow

Moments
In another world
A world that makes sense
While an old familiar world
On the other side
Of a vaporous wall
Suddenly, makes no sense at all

Fading
Tearing the fabrics of realities
Called back to the other side
Safe behind the solid wall
Which disappears

And then
Back in this world
The reality blow fading
Into a fractured memory
Like waking from a dream

Sensing
Once again a world
Beyond a wall
I cannot see
Cannot breach

Then hide
Ignore
Dissociate
Repress
The wall between
Me and me

Forget
I am always choosing
Which side of the wall
I wish to be on
Which world is mine

Today
I remember
And wonder
Am I
The only one

The Pic and a Word Challenge is a weekly creativity prompt offered Sunday mornings.

Each week I provide a photograph of mine along with a single word. The challenge? Use the pic and/or word as points of inspiration to create something — a photograph, a painting, prose, poetry, fiction, non-fiction, longread or just a few words. You are welcome to use these two elements (photograph and word) literally, thematically or metaphorically. If you create both images and words, all the better.
